Gaza, Rafah border crossing and Egypt
Sick and wounded Palestinians leave Gaza as Rafah crossing reopens
Thirty-seven sick and wounded Palestinians have left Gaza for medical treatment in Egypt following the reopening of the Rafah border crossing after eight months. The World Health Organization (WHO) said on X that 34 children and three adults, along with 39 companions, crossed out of Gaza to receive treatment in Egypt.

Egypt: Egypt receives the first group of wounded and sick from Gaza through the Rafah crossing
Egypt received on Saturday the first group of 50 wounded and sick from the Gaza Strip through the Rafah border crossing, which had been closed since last May, in the framework of the current ceasefire between Israel and the Palestinian group Hamas.
